Jem Aswad Senior Music EditorA 77-track benefit album featuring Pearl Jam, David Byrne, Aimee Mann and many others raised more than $550,000 for voting-rights organizations on Friday, the only day it was available.
The album, the second volume of the “Good Music to Avert the Collapse of American Democracy” series, was available as a download for $20.20 on Bandcamp for just one day and featured dozens of previously unreleased tracks, with all net proceeds going to the Voting Rights Lab.Further details on the album and the full tracklist can be found here, although it is no longer available.The first compilation raised more than $250,000 for the Fair Fight and Color of Change organizations.The team responsible for pulling the charity.
